Hyperdimension Neptunia Re;Birth 1 & 2 Head Westward
- Categories: Games, News
- Date: Dec 27, 2014 03:22 JST
- Tags: Announcements, Idea Factory, Neptunia, PC Gaming, Steam, Translation
Established game developer Idea Factory has revealed that their hit titles Fairy Fencer F, Hyperdimension Neptunia Re;Birth 1 and its sequel are due to receive PC iterations through Steam – an act that eager fans have been waiting an eternity for.
This is not the first time a Neptunia game has arrived in the west, and may perhaps not be the last considering the growing popularity for the series – though hopefully this time the release will not cause any lunacy amongst western fans or overmuch whiteknighting histrionics from the international gaming media.
No release dates have been announced for the games as of yet.
